Brief History

Naga Hope Christian School, formerly Hope Christian School is a non-stock, non-profit, non-sectarian and co-educational institution.

The idea to open a Christian school in Naga City was born in 1954 by some Elders and Deacons of the United Evangelical Church of Naga City (UECN). Foremost to their vision is to provide quality education, minster to the spiritual needs and help remedy the moral degeneration of our society. But due to the limited resources, the idea was not pursued for 4 years.

In 1958 a free tuition kindergarden was opened as a branch of Hope Christian High School, Manila by Rev. Robin Chua with a batch of 30 children. The school was named Naga Hope Christian Kindergarden. Teachers and the principal served voluntarily and heartily.

The management of the school was placed in the hands of the trustees composed of Bro. Dy Yok as Chairman, Mr. Dy Chiao Yok as Vice-Chairman and Mrs. Dy Yu Kun Giok as Head Teacher. In June 1960, Grade 1 was offered and the school name was changed to Naga Hope Christian School.

In 1965, two kindergarden classes and a complete elementary were offered. In the same year, the school was granted recognition by the Bureau of education and the Chinese Embassy in Manila. In 1982, the Board saw the need to open the elementary level in order to accommodate the elementary graduates who prefer to stay with the school.

In 1984, the First Year High School was opened, Second Year in 1985, Third Year and Forth in the following year.

From 1958 to 1985, the school had been using the church site, building and facilities in Tabuco, Naga City to accommodate the students. But on February 25, 1986, the new school site at Panganiban Drive, Naga City was opened. This was made possible through the efforts of Rev. John Pan, Mr. Oscar Ong, and Robert Tan, and through the generosity of Mr. Ung Han Liong, Mr. Go Pin Sing, and Mr. John Ong.

In March 1986, the consistory board of the United Evangelical Church of Naga financed the construction of a new one-story building that includes 7 classrooms. This was made possible thanks to the assitant of Elder Shangknan and Arch. Philip Recto of the United Evangelical Church of The Philippines. In 1988, another group of Christian members from Manila financed the construction of a new building and in 1990 another new building was finished.

Since that time on, the school continued to grom in enrollment, facilities and in academic achievement. The school consistently achieved 100% passing in the National College Entrance Exam (NCEE) since the first secondary students graduated. In May 2002, the school attained her acredited status granted by the Association of Christian Schools, Colleges and Universities Accrediting Agency Incorporated (ACSCU-AAI), a member of Federation of Accrediting Agency of The Philippines (FAAP).

In May 2012, in recongnition of the school's continuing commitment to quality education undergirded with faithful Christian values towards institutional and national growth and development the ACSCU-AAI granted our school the Level II Reaccredited status.

Our Philosophy

The essence of education is personal knowledge of God, responsibility towards nature and society and improvement of the quality of life.

Our Vision and Mission


Vision

Transformation of society through the gospel of Jesus Christ and meaningful education amoung the youth.

Mission

Naga Hope Christian School is committed to provide quality education anchored in Biblical principles, so that every pupil or student will have a strong foundation of learning and in facing future challenges in life.

Statement of Faith

  • We believe that the bible is composed of the 66 books of the Old and New Testament, is inerrant and verbally inspired of God in all its parts, and is supreme and final authority in Christian faith and living.

  • We believe in one Triune God, eternally existing in three Persons, Father, Son, and Holy Spirit, co-identical in nature, co-equal in power and glory, and having the same attributes and perfections.

  • We believe that the the Lord Jesus Christ, the only begotten Son of God, become man, without ceasing to be God, having been conceived by the Holy Ghost and born of the Virgin Mary, in order that He might reveal God and redeem sinful men.

  • We believe that the Holy Spirit is the Third Person of the Triune God and who convicts the world of sin, of righteousness, and of judgment; and that He baptizes and indwells all believers, sealing them unto the day of redemption at the moment of their regeneration.

  • We believe that man was created in the image and likeness of God, but that in Adam’s sin the human race fell, inherited a sinful nature, and became alienated from God; and, that unregenerate man is spiritually dead, and utterly unable of himself to remedy his lost condition.

  • We believe …that salvation is the gift of God brought to man wholly by grace alone and received by personal faith in the Lord Jesus Christ, whose precious blood was shed on Calvary for the forgiveness of sins, and that apart from Christ there is no possible salvation.

  • We believe that all the redeemed, once saved, are kept by God’s power, secured in Christ forever, and guaranteed never to perish; and, that it is the privilege of believers to rejoice in the assurance of salvation through the testimony of God’s Word, which, however, clearly forbids the use of Christian liberty as an occasion to the flesh.

  • We believe that every saved person possesses two natures — the old and the new nature and that although the old nature can never be eradicated in this life, provision has been made for victory of the new nature over the old nature through the power of the indwelling Holy Spirit.

  • We believe that a New Testament church is a local body of born- again believers associated together for worship, observance of the ordinances of the church, and the spread of the Gospel to all the world. All true Christians are also members of the Universal Church which began at the Day of Pentecost.

  • We believe that there are two ordinance which believers are to observe until He comes—Believers Baptism and the Lord’s Supper; and that the immersion of a believer in water baptism in the name of the Father, Son and holy Spirit sets forth the essential facts of redemption (the death and resurrection of Christ) and also the essential outlook of the believer death to sin and alive unto God.

  • We believe in the personal existence of Satan, the great adversary of God and His people, who is judge at the cross and whose final doom is certain; and, that Christians are able to resist and overcome Satan and his demons through the blood of the Lamb and the whole armor of God.

  • We believe in the imminent return of the Lord for His church efore the Seven Year Tribulation Period, and in His subsequent glorious and visible return to the earth with His saint to establish His millennial kingdom.

  • We believe in the bodily resurrection of all men — the saved to eternal conscious bliss with the Lord, and the unsaved to everlasting, conscious punishing in the lake of fire.
